Velvet classic

‘Retaliation yes, escalation no’: Former Head of Israeli Defense Intelligence reacts to strike on Iran

Bianna Golodryga speaks to Amos Yadlin, former head of Israeli Defense Intelligence.Bianna Golodryga speaks to Amos Yadlin, former head of Israeli Defense Intelligence.

Exit mobile version